I am not sure if you have tamed 2 birds or 1 by it self before but it is a lot easier to tame 1 on it's own then 2 together since they tend to bond and mimic each other's behavior. You may want to try different taming tricks with both of them and use millet. Using positive techinques can go along way. You may want to even try clicker training it has been very successful in all types of animals including birds. Clicker Training you can google the website.
